WhiteLabelPartner.com launches white-label GoHighLevel services for agencies

Sep. 2, 2026
By AI, Created 04:58 UTC, Sep 02, 2026, AGP -

WhiteLabelPartner.com has introduced white-label GoHighLevel services to help agencies handle CRM, automation, and funnel work without adding internal staff. The offering is designed to let agencies stay client-facing while White Label Partner manages implementation and technical delivery behind the scenes.

Why it matters: - Agencies can expand client delivery without hiring a dedicated internal team for every platform. - The new service gives agencies a way to offer CRM, automation, reporting, and support under their own brand. - The model is aimed at helping agencies keep ownership of client relationships while outsourcing technical execution.

What happened: - WhiteLabelPartner.com launched white-label GoHighLevel services for digital agencies. - The offering covers backend implementation, CRM setup, automation, and funnel support. - White Label Partner handles technical delivery while agencies stay client-facing. - Details are available at the GoHighLevel services page.

The details: - The service supports complete account builds, migrations, and selected parts of existing GoHighLevel setups. - Included capabilities cover GHL setup, consulting, and account planning. - The package also includes CRM pipelines, lead tracking, dashboards, and reporting. - Agencies can also use funnels, landing pages, and websites through the service. - The offering includes email and SMS workflows, AI agents, and automated follow-up. - Calendars, forms, booking systems, and payment gateways are part of the support list. - Snapshots, third-party integrations, migrations, and white-label support are included. - Each engagement can be tailored to the client’s existing systems, business goals, and technical support needs.

Between the lines: - The launch extends White Label Partner’s broader work across digital marketing, development, content, AI, and automation. - The company is positioning itself as a delivery layer for agencies that need more capacity without expanding payroll. - CEO Ali Raza said agencies are being asked to do more, but building a team for every platform is not practical. - Raza said the value comes from connecting the CRM, communications, and workflows so agencies can adjust as client needs change.

What's next: - White Label Partner will continue planning, testing, and managing delivery on behalf of agencies. - Agencies using the service can add recurring CRM, automation, reporting, and support offerings. - The company is also directing prospects to its main site for more information at WhiteLabelPartner.com.

The bottom line: - WhiteLabelPartner.com is betting that agencies want more service capacity without more headcount, and that white-label GoHighLevel delivery can fill that gap.
